Rockies’ Gomber tops players in Tuesday, March 30’s final spring training games

Rockies pitcher Austin Gomber is Box-Toppers Player of the Day in Tuesday’s final spring training games.

Gomber struck out four over three scoreless innings, allowing two hits and no walks, in the 2-1, seven-inning win over the White Sox. Gomber did not earn the win, picking up a no-decision, because the White Sox tied the game after he exited.

Giants’ Andrew Suarez tops players for Saturday, June 2; Rangers’ Hamels tops AL players

Giants pitcher Andrew Suarez is Saturday’s Box-Toppers Player of the Day.

Suarez struck out five over seven scoreless innings, allowing three hits and no walks, in the 2-0 win over the Phillies.
